40 is the new 60? StoryFirst founder on why you should not wait for the next job in your 40s and 50s

In a recent LinkedIn post titled “40 is the new 60”, Mudnaney shared his personal journey of voluntarily stepping away from a stable paycheck in his 50s — a move he admits was risky but ultimately transformative. “If I failed, there would be no job waiting for me,” he wrote. “But I jumped. Burnt the bridges.”
Drawing from over a decade of experience since leaving corporate life, Mudnaney outlined 13 lessons for those in their 40s and 50s — from accepting ageism and building networks early, to maintaining health and embracing reinvention.
“Don’t wait for tomorrow. Live with curiosity, not fear,” he advised, stressing the importance of action over hesitation. He urged professionals to start contributing immediately after a job loss, whether through volunteering, consulting, or entrepreneurial projects, warning that “waiting will only chip away at your confidence. Action rebuilds it.”
Mudnaney also underscored the value of personal branding, continuous learning, and community connections, adding that titles are temporary but self-leadership is permanent: “You are the CEO of your life. Own that role.”
His post resonated with thousands, tapping into a growing conversation about career longevity, economic uncertainty, and the need for proactive planning well before retirement age.
For those navigating a “Second Act,” Mudnaney recommends his books From Success to Significance and Jump Off the Cliff — both drawn from his own leap into the unknown.
“The best chapters,” he concluded, “are yet to be written.”
